Preparation of alpha,beta-dihalogenopropionitrile

1979 
PURPOSE: To obtain the titled compound useful as a raw material for a physiologically active substance, etc. in high yield industrially advantagenously, by halogenating acrylonitrile directly in the presence of a specific catalyst under specified conditions. CONSTITUTION: Acrylonitrile is hlaogenated directly in the presence of an acid amine in a molar ratio of it: acrylonitrile of 1:0.05W2.0 in the absence of light at -70W75°C to give a reaction product, which is distilled under reduced pressure, to give an α,β-dihalogenopropionitrile in high selectivity and conversion. Formaldehyde, etc. may be cited as the acid amide, and 2-aminoethanolamine, etc. as the ethanolamine. EFFECT: Any by-products are hardly formed. There are neither problem of recovery of pyridiene nor that of liquid-waste treatment. A catalyst containing about 0.5wt% water, a technical grade, is used without any problems.
